Sheikh Matar Mosque
Sheikh Matar Mosque or Sheikh Mutahhar Mosque is a historical mosque in Diyarbakır, Turkey, best known for its unique minaret based on four columns, dubbed the Four-legged Minaret.Photo: MikaelF, CC BY-SA 3.0.

Behram Pasha Mosque
Mosque
Photo: Sonrisa,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Behram Pasha Mosque is a 16th-century Ottoman mosque located in the town of Diyarbakır in southeast Turkey. It was commissioned by the Ottoman governor-general Behram Pasha. Behram Pasha Mosque is situated 330 metres southwest of Sheikh Matar Mosque.

Diyarbakır
Photo: Adam Jones,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Diyarbakır is the largest city in Southeastern Anatolia. It is on the Tigris, one of the greatest rivers of the Middle East, and is considered by many to be the capital of the Kurdish people.
Yenişehir
Town
Photo: Sonrisa,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Yenişehir is a municipality and district of Diyarbakır Province, Turkey. Its area is 358 km2, and its population is 219,759. It covers the southwestern part of the city of Diyarbakır and the adjacent countryside.
